@charset "utf-8";
/* CSS Document */

html, body, div, p, ul, li, dl, dt, dd, h1, h2, h3, h4, h5, h6, form, input, select, button, textarea, iframe, table, th, td { margin:0 auto; padding: 0; }
img { border: 0 none;  }
ul, li { list-style-type: none; }
h2, h5 { font-weight:100;}
h2, h4, h6{ font-size:12px;}
h1, h3, h5{ font-size: 14px; }
body, input, select, button, textarea { font-size: 12px; font-family:Arial, Helvetica, sans-serif; margin:0; }
button { cursor: pointer; }
body { color: #535353; line-height: 1.2;  }
a, a:link { text-decoration: none; }
a{ color:#535353;}
a:hover{ color:#3dac22; }
a:active, a:hover { text-decoration: underline; }
div{ overflow:hidden;}


/*头部*/
.x-top{ width:100%; box-shadow: 0px 1px 3px rgba(0, 0, 0, 0.2); background:#FFFFFF; z-index:2;}
.x-top1{ width:1000px;padding:10px 0;}
.x-top1a{ float:left;}
.x-top1b{ float:right;}
.x-top2{ width:100%; border-top:3px solid #2B7DC3; text-align:center; line-height:50px;}
.x-top2 a{ margin-left:20px; margin-right:20px; font-size:18px; color:#545454;}

/*banner*/
.x-banner{ width:100%; height:500px; background:url(../images/x-banner01.jpg) top center no-repeat;}

/*就业前景*/
.x-jyqj{ width:1000px; line-height:33px; margin-top:20px;}
.x-jyqj span{ width:100%; display:block; font-size:24px; color:#FF0000;}
.x-jyqj p{ font-size:16px; color:#555555; margin-top:5px; margin-bottom:5px;}
.x-jyqj p b{ font-size:24px; color:#FF0000; line-height:33px; float:left; } 
.x-jyqj img{ display:block;}

/*权威证书*/
.x-qwzs{ width:1000px;}
.x-qwzs1{ width:100%; height:63px; background:url(../images/x-qwzs01.gif) top center no-repeat; line-height:46px; font-size:24px; color:#FFFFFF; text-align: center; font-weight:bold;}
.x-qwzs2{ width:100%; text-align:center; line-height:36px; font-size:24px; color:#FF0000; font-weight:bold;}
.x-qwzs3{ width:100%; height:400px; background:url(../images/x-qwzs02.jpg) center top no-repeat;}
.x-qwzs4{ width:100%; height:270px; background:url(../images/x-qwzs03.jpg) center top no-repeat;}
.x-qwzs5{ width:100%; height:317px; background:url(../images/x-qwzs04.jpg) center top no-repeat;}

/*报名入口*/
.x-bmrk{ width:100%; max-width:1000px; margin-top:20px;}
.x-bmrk1{ width:980px; height:72px; border:1px solid #C30D23; box-sizing:border-box; line-height:70px; text-align:center; font-size:32px;}
.x-bmrk1 a{ color:#C30D23;}
.x-bmrk1:hover{ border:1px solid #00ABC9;}
.x-bmrk1:hover a{ color:#00ABC9; text-decoration:none;}
.x-bmrk2{ width:100%; margin-top:20px;}
.x-bmrk2 img{ display:block; margin:0 auto;}

/*课程体系*/
.x-kctx{ width:100%; margin-top:20px;}
.x-kctx1{ width:100%; text-align:center; padding:20px 0; line-height:35px;}
.x-kctx1 span{ display:block; width:100%; font-size:34px; color:#c21028;}
.x-kctx1 p{ display:block; font-size:18px; color:#7d7d7d;}
.x-kctx1 b{ display:block; width:100%;color:#c21028; font-size:24px; font-weight:normal; line-height:25px;}
.x-kctx2{ width:100%; height:500px; background:url(../images/x-kctx01.jpg) center top no-repeat;}
.x-kctx3{ width:100%; height:558px; background:url(../images/x-kctx02.jpg) center top no-repeat;}
.x-kctx4{ width:100%; height:600px; background:url(../images/x-kctx03.jpg) center top no-repeat;}

/*师资力量*/
.x-szll{ width:100%; margin-top:20px;}
.x-szll1{ width:100%; text-align:center; padding:20px 0; line-height:35px;}
.x-szll1 span{ display:block; width:100%; font-size:34px; color:#c21028;}
.x-szll1 p{ display:block; font-size:18px; color:#7d7d7d;}
.x-szll1 b{ display:block; width:100%;color:#c21028; font-size:24px; font-weight:normal; line-height:25px;}
.x-szll2{ width:100%; height:514px; background:url(../images/x-szll01.jpg) center top no-repeat;}
.x-szll3{width:100%; height:63px; background:url(../images/x-qwzs01.gif) top center no-repeat; line-height:46px; font-size:24px; color:#FFFFFF; text-align: center; font-weight:bold;}
.x-szll4{ width:100%; height:247px; background:url(../images/x-szll02.gif) top center no-repeat;}

/*学员感言*/
.x-xygy{ width:100%;}
.x-xygy1{width:100%; height:63px; background:url(../images/x-qwzs01.gif) top center no-repeat; line-height:46px; font-size:24px; color:#FFFFFF; text-align: center; font-weight:bold;}
.x-xygy2{ width:100%; line-height:40px; text-align:center; font-size:18px; color:#FF0000; font-weight:bold;}
.x-xygy3{ width:100%; margin-top:40px; max-width:980px;}
.picScroll{ position:relative; width:100%;}
.picScroll .bd1{  overflow:hidden; width:92%; }
.picScroll .tempWrap{ margin:0 auto; width:100%;}
.picScroll .bd1 li{ width:33.333333%; float:left;}
.picScroll .bd1 li p{ width:95%; border:1px solid #dddddd; padding:10px; box-sizing:border-box; line-height:25px; font-size:14px; height:210px;-moz-border-radius:5px;-webkit-border-radius:5px;border-radius:5px;}
.picScroll .bd1 li p span{ width:100%; display:block; text-align:right;font-size:14px; margin-top:10px;}
.picScroll .prev{ position:absolute; top:85px; left:0px; cursor:pointer; z-index:9999; background: url(../images/x-xygy01.jpg) no-repeat; width:17px; height:58px; text-indent:-9999px;}
.picScroll .next{ position:absolute; top:85px; right:0px; cursor:pointer; z-index:9999; background:url(../images/x-xygy02.jpg) no-repeat; width:17px; height:58px; text-indent:-9999px;}

/*知名企业*/
.x-zmqy{ width:100%; margin-top:40px;}
.x-zmqy1{width:100%; height:63px; background:url(../images/x-qwzs01.gif) top center no-repeat; line-height:46px; font-size:24px; color:#FFFFFF; text-align: center; font-weight:bold;}
.x-zmqy2{ width:100%; height:309px; background:url(../images/x-zmqy01.gif) top center no-repeat;}
.x-zmqy3{ width:100%; height:535px; background:url(../images/x-zmqy02.gif) top center no-repeat;}

/*常见问题*/
.x-cjwt{ width:100%;}
.x-cjwt1{ width:100%; height:117px; background:url(../images/x-cjwt01.jpg) center top no-repeat;}
.x-cjwt2{ width:100%; line-height:25px; text-align:center; max-width:980px;}
.x-cjwt2 p{ font-size:14px; color:#464646;}
.x-cjwt2 p b{ line-height:30px; font-size:21px; color:#464646; margin-top:10px; display:block;}
.x-cjwt2 p span{ color:#C30D23; font-size:16px; font-weight:bold;}
.x-cjwt2 a{ display:block; text-align:center;}
.x-cjwt2 a img{ display:block; margin:0 auto;}
.x-cjwt3{ width:100%; height:135px; background:url(../images/x-cjwt03.jpg) top center no-repeat;}
.x-cjwt4{ width:100%; height:131px; background:url(../images/x-cjwt04.jpg) top center no-repeat;}
.x-cjwt5{ width:100%; height:58px; background:url(../images/x-cjwt05.jpg) top center no-repeat;}
.x-cjwt6{color:#C30D23; font-size:16px; font-weight:bold; width:100%; line-height:30px; text-align:center;}
.x-cjwt7{ width:100%; max-width:980px;}
.picScrol2{ position:relative; width:100%;}
.picScrol2 .bd2{  overflow:hidden; width:100%; }
.picScrol2 .tempWrap{ margin:0 auto; width:100%;}
.picScrol2 .bd2 li{ width:11.11111111%; float:left; text-align:center;}
.picScrol2 .bd2 li img{ width:100%; height:130px; padding:1px; box-sizing:border-box;}
.picScrol2 .bd2 li span{ line-height:30px; color:#666666; font-size:12px;}
.picScrol2 .bd2 li p span{ width:100%; display:block; text-align:right;font-size:14px; margin-top:10px;}

/*底部开始*/
.x-foot{ width:100%;}
.x-foot1{ width:100%; height:417px; background:url(../images/x-foot01.jpg) center top no-repeat;}
.x-foot2{ width:100%; height:451px; background:url(../images/x-foot02.jpg) center top no-repeat;}
.x-foot3{ width:100%; background:url(../images/x-foot03.gif) center top no-repeat #2C7EC2; height:525px;}
.x-foot3 p{ line-height:67px; color:#FFFFFF; font-size:45px; text-align:center; font-weight:bold; margin-top:110px;}
.x-foot3 span{ display:block; margin-top:20px;}
.x-foot3 span a{ display:block; width:459px; height:164px; margin:0 auto; background:url(../images/x-foot04.jpg);}
.x-foot3 span a:hover{background:url(../images/x-foot05.jpg);}
.x-foot3 b{ display:block; margin-top:-15px;}
.x-foot3 a{ display:block; width:100%; text-align:center;}
.x-foot3 a img{ display:block; margin:0 auto;}

/*左侧悬浮*/
.x-zcxf{ position:fixed; top:130px; left:10px;}
.x-zcxf li{ width:110px; height:40px; background:#2B7DC3; line-height:40px; text-align:center; margin-bottom:4px; font-size:14px;}
.x-zcxf li a{ color:#FFFFFF;}
.x-zcxf li:hover{ background:#C30D23;}
#x-zcxf1{ background:#C30D23;}